If an A4 sheet is cut exactly in half along a line parallel to the shorter side, two sheets are created that have the same shape as the original one, that is, they are obtained from it by a rotation and a scaling. This year we will say that a rectangular sheet is "contemporary" if, by cutting it into 2020 equal parts obtained with cuts parallel to its shorter side, one obtains 2020 rectangles that have the same shape as the initial one. If the short side of a contemporary sheet measures 1, how long is the other side?

Solution:
The answer is (A). Let us denote by x the length of the long side of the contemporary sheet. The cut-out rectangles have the same ratio between the sides, but we know that their long side measures 1, while their short side measures 2020x. Writing the equality between the ratios, that is, the proportion, we have: x:1=1:2020x from which x2=2020 that is x=2020
